Skip to content

Commit 34880cc

Browse files
committed
integration: log dockerd cmd
Signed-off-by: CrazyMax <[email protected]>
1 parent e4c0cd6 commit 34880cc

File tree

2 files changed

+3
-3
lines changed

2 files changed

+3
-3
lines changed

util/testutil/dockerd/daemon.go

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-2,6 +2,7 @@ package dockerd
22

33
import (
44
"bytes"
5+
"fmt"
56
"io"
67
"os"
78
"os/exec"
@@ -137,6 +138,7 @@ func (d *Daemon) StartWithError(daemonLogs map[string]*bytes.Buffer, providedArg
137138
d.cmd.Stderr = &lockingWriter{Writer: b}
138139
}
139140

141+
fmt.Fprintf(d.cmd.Stderr, "> startCmd %v %+v\n", time.Now(), d.cmd.String())
140142
if err := d.cmd.Start(); err != nil {
141143
return errors.Wrapf(err, "[%s] could not start daemon container", d.id)
142144
}

util/testutil/integration/dockerd.go

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,6 @@
11
package integration
22

33
import (
4-
"bytes"
54
"context"
65
"encoding/json"
76
"io"
@@ -141,9 +140,8 @@ func (c moby) New(ctx context.Context, cfg *BackendConfig) (b Backend, cl func()
141140
}
142141
deferF.append(d.StopWithError)
143142

144-
logs := map[string]*bytes.Buffer{}
145143
if err := waitUnix(d.Sock(), 5*time.Second); err != nil {
146-
return nil, nil, errors.Errorf("dockerd did not start up: %q, %s", err, formatLogs(logs))
144+
return nil, nil, errors.Errorf("dockerd did not start up: %q, %s", err, formatLogs(cfg.Logs))
147145
}
148146

149147
dockerAPI, err := client.NewClientWithOpts(client.WithHost(d.Sock()))

0 commit comments

Comments
 (0)